Comprehending Counterfeit Money
Counterfeit money is defined as imitation currency produced with the intent to utilize it as if it were genuine. The inspirations behind counterfeiting consist of fraud, earnings maximization, and financial destabilization. Suppliers of counterfeit currency vary extensively, from private bad guys producing notes in the house to advanced criminal organizations efficient in counterfeiting high-quality currency that carefully looks like authentic bills.

The production, distribution, and usage of counterfeit money are felonies in the majority of jurisdictions worldwide. In the United States, for instance, penalties can include extensive prison sentences, fines, and restitution. Many nations have actually enacted stringent laws to protect their currencies, making counterfeiting an attractive however highly harmful business.

The impacts of counterfeit money extend beyond private losses; they impact economies on multiple levels:
